An Olympic torch bearer will visit the Three Rivers Museum to give Rickmansworth residents a chance to see the famous torch.

Alice Breheny completed her leg of the torch relay in Hatfield on July 8, and has raising tens of thousands of pounds for Cancer Research UK.

The 38-year-old will visit the museum, in the High Street, on August 11 from 11am to 12.30pm.

She posthumously nominated her sister, who died from brain cancer last year, with the aim of carrying the torch in her honour.

Since her death Ms Breheny said she focussed on raising money for research into brain cancer and this year alone has collected £35,000.
